是指在特定条件下运行jQuery函数来处理文件上传的情况。jQuery是一种流行的JavaScript库,用于简化HTML文档遍历、事件处理、动画效果等操作。在文件上传的场景中,可以使用jQuery来监听文件上传的状态,并根据文件是否已经上传或未上传来执行相应的操作。
具体实现的代码可以如下所示:
// 监听文件上传按钮的点击事件
$('#uploadButton').click(function() {
// 获取文件上传的状态
var fileUploaded = checkFileUploaded();
// 判断文件是否已经上传
if (fileUploaded) {
// 执行已上传文件的处理函数
handleUploadedFile();
} else {
// 执行未上传文件的处理函数
handleUnuploadedFile();
}
});
// 检查文件是否已经上传的函数
function checkFileUploaded() {
// 在这里编写检查文件是否已经上传的逻辑
// 返回一个布尔值,表示文件是否已经上传
}
// 处理已上传文件的函数
function handleUploadedFile() {
// 在这里编写处理已上传文件的逻辑
}
// 处理未上传文件的函数
function handleUnuploadedFile() {
// 在这里编写处理未上传文件的逻辑
}
在上述代码中,checkFileUploaded()
函数用于检查文件是否已经上传,根据实际情况编写相应的逻辑。handleUploadedFile()
函数用于处理已上传文件的情况,可以在该函数中执行相关的操作,如保存文件、显示文件信息等。handleUnuploadedFile()
函数用于处理未上传文件的情况,可以在该函数中执行相应的提示或其他操作。
需要注意的是,上述代码中使用了jQuery库,因此在使用之前需要确保已经引入了jQuery库文件。另外,具体的文件上传处理逻辑需要根据实际需求进行编写。
关于腾讯云相关产品和产品介绍链接地址,可以根据具体需求选择适合的产品,如对象存储 COS、云函数 SCF、云数据库 CDB 等。具体的产品介绍和文档可以在腾讯云官网进行查阅。
领取专属 10元无门槛券
手把手带您无忧上云